Transaction 654984e7259efdfe9a62829c3e0eb066a7671d9f9a6b82764a96d2dc31979598
1 Input
1 Output
-
654984e7259efdfe9a62829c3e0eb066a7671d9f9a6b82764a96d2dc31979598:0
- value
- 3204600
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 431d152e52f2fd345b86e5479bf503889f800ee1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 177s7ZHm85wEbFZ1LVq8QmqE5Sbsa1g5Fn